Small clean RV park, all level gravel, 20,30 and 50A full hookups. Owners very friendly & knowledgeable of area. 10 sites, owner puts guest away from of the RV’s when possible. Very clean with great water pressure and clean power. Owner very knowledgeable of area and nearby points of interest. Rest room on grounds, residential style sh... more
Small clean RV park, all level gravel, 20,30 and 50A full hookups. Owners very friendly & knowledgeable of area. 10 sites, owner puts guest away from of the RV’s when possible. Very clean with great water pressure and clean power. Owner very knowledgeable of area and nearby points of interest. Rest room on grounds, residential style shower inside main building for $3 fee, and it is spotless. Two + acres of lunch green grass for dogs to run just behind RV parking area. The RV site is aboutt 8 miles south of Socorro and exactly 2.5 miles south (NM-1) of 4 way stop at flashing light in village of San Antonio (US 380 and NM 1, at Owl Cafe). CAUTION: Google and other apps will lead you astray! It is also just minutes north of Bosque Del Apache National Wildlife Area.
